When you think to have Pure your homeland meal this could work, Tamilnadu style meals priced at Rs 170, comes with Apalam,Two types of Sambar, brinjal curry,batha kolambu, cabbage puriyal and rasam but price is high towards quantity and quality.
Located near to Hanuman temple.

They offer different varieties of south indian delicacies like dosa, vada, idli, uthapam, rasam rice, sambar rice etc.. In dosa itself there are different varieties and I have tried most of them. I would recommend coconut rava masala dosa and the madurai special dosa as they are my favorites and they are delicious. Dosa is served with coconut chutney, sambar and one more chutney (i think tomato but not sure)they also taste awesome. As soon as you have a seat they will serve you with sambar, we generally finish the saambar even before they serve dosa and they will happily serve extra sambar when they bring the order to the table. One can ask for extra chutney and sambar and they'll never refuse or charge extra. I have also tried their vada and idli and both were soft and tasty. I once tried their uthapam but i didn't liked it. Also I once went with 3 of my friends and we ordered their 2 ft long dosa (i don't remember the name) and it was also delicious and enough for 4 of us (see pic). I think it costed us INR400. Their dosas start from INR 80 to 170 and the prices might be a liiiiitle high as compared to other such local food joints but its worth the taste. They have 4 tables inside and i think 4 to 5 outside with seating capacity of 4 individuals.
